Understanding Ad Exchanges: A Beginner's Guide

Ad networks can look complex, but they are fundamentally marketplaces in which publishers list their ad slots to advertisers . Think of it as a virtual auction space; when a user loads a website , an ad exchange automatically assesses present ad opportunities from multiple ad networks to determine the best bid for serve a relevant ad. This process ensures advertisers get reach and publishers optimize their earnings .

Ad Platform vs. Demand-Side System : Main Variations Explained

Understanding the essential roles of an advertising platform and a DSP solution is critical for anyone involved in online media. A demand-side platform largely functions as a buying system allowing marketers to secure ad impressions from multiple websites. Unlike, an ad marketplace acts as a unified hub whereby sellers can list their ad inventory to numerous buyers . Essentially, the demand-side platform utilizes the advertising exchange to locate and acquire ad impressions , while the platform itself alone isn't placing those individual acquisition decisions .

How Ad Platforms Drive Real-Time Sales (RTB)

Ad exchanges are essential components in the mechanism of powering Real-Time Auctions (RTB). They function as unified hubs where publishers list their ad inventory and marketers submit proposals instantly . When a visitor visits a site, the publisher's ad network sends a request to several ad marketplaces. These marketplaces then host an auction among multiple marketers, who are vying for the possibility to show their ad to that specific consumer. The winning bid earns the impression , and the ad is shown almost rapidly, thanks to the speed of the RTB system .
